The station wagon Mazda 6 2012 - 2015 year modification 2.2 AT (175 hp)

Engine

Engine type diesel
Engine location front, transverse
Engine capacity, cm³ 2191
Boost type turbocharging
Maximum power, hp/kW at rpm 175 / 129 at 4500
Maximum torque, N*m at rpm 420 at 2000
Cylinder arrangement in-line
Number of cylinders 4
Number of valves per cylinder 4
Engine power supply system direct injection into the combustion chamber
Compression ratio 14
Cylinder diameter and piston stroke, mm 86 × 94.3

General information

Brand country Japan
Model assembly Japan
Car class D
Number of doors 5

Performance indicators

Maximum speed, km/h 215
Acceleration to 100 km/h, s 8.6
Ecological class Euro 6
CO2 emissions, g/km 129
Fuel consumption, l city / highway / combined 6.1 / 4.2 / 4.9
Fuel type diesel fuel

Security

Safety assessment 5
Rating name Euro NCAP

Sizes in mm

Front track width 1585
Rear track width 1575
Wheel size 225 / 55 / R17 225 / 45 / R19
Length 4805
Width 1840
Height 1480
Wheelbase 2750
Ground clearance 165

Suspension and brakes

Type of front suspension independent, spring
Type of rear suspension independent, spring
Front brakes disk ventilated
Rear brakes disc

Transmission

Transmission automatic
Number of gears 6
Drive type front

Volume and weight

Fuel tank capacity, l 62
Curb weight, kg 1430
Trunk volume min/max, l 522
Gross weight, kg 1930

Engine and Transmission

Under the hood, the Mazda 6 features a 2191 cm³ diesel engine with turbocharging, delivering 175 horsepower at 4500 rpm and a maximum torque of 420 N*m at 2000 rpm. The engine's direct injection system and in-line 4-cylinder configuration ensure optimal performance and fuel efficiency. Paired with a 6-speed automatic transmission, the car offers seamless gear shifts and a responsive driving experience. The front-wheel-drive system further enhances its handling, making it a joy to drive on both city streets and highways.

Design and Dimensions

The Mazda 6 station wagon boasts a sleek and aerodynamic design, with dimensions of 4805 mm in length, 1840 mm in width, and 1480 mm in height. Its 2750 mm wheelbase provides ample interior space, while the ground clearance of 165 mm ensures a comfortable ride on various terrains. The car's spacious trunk offers a minimum volume of 522 liters, making it ideal for family trips or hauling cargo. With a curb weight of 1430 kg and a gross weight of 1930 kg, the Mazda 6 strikes a perfect balance between durability and agility.
